Bharat Dynamics Ltd to Establish New Manufacturing Facilities.
Bharat Dynamics Ltd is set to enhance its production capacity with the establishment of two new manufacturing facilities in Ibrahimpatnam, Hyderabad, Telangana, and Jhansi, Uttar Pradesh. The inaugurations are expected shortly, with production slated to begin in the financial year 2026-27.
The Ibrahimpatnam facility will feature eight assembly lines designed to support new weapon systems and anticipated future requirements of the Indian armed forces. It will also house specialized testing capabilities, including a rocket motor testing facility and a warhead penetration testing facility, enhancing BDL’s operational efficiency and product diversification.
Meanwhile, the Jhansi facility, located within the UP Defence Corridor, will focus on propellant manufacturing to meet growing organizational demands. The unit will also handle bulk production of Grad rockets and in-house R&D for new energetics, supporting innovation in missile technology.
These expansions align with BDL’s current order book of approximately Rs. 26,000 crore, with additional orders estimated at Rs. 15,000 crore for FY27. The move is part of the company’s broader strategy to increase capacity, improve operational efficiency, and diversify its defense product portfolio.
